🎛️ Every filter YouTube has — not a hand-picked subset
Most YouTube search scrapers ship a fixed lookup table of pre-baked filter strings, so you get whatever combinations somebody typed out by hand. This actor encodes YouTube's search protobuf properly, so the entire cross-product is reachable:
| Filter | Values |
|---|---|
sortBy | relevance · uploadDate · viewCount · rating |
uploadDate | any · lastHour · today · thisWeek · thisMonth · thisYear |
resultType | video (default) · any · shorts · channel · playlist · movie |
duration | any · under3min · from3to20min · over20min |
features | live · fourK · hd · subtitles · creativeCommons · threeSixty · vr180 · threeD · hdr · location · purchased |
And it checks itself. Every search response carries YouTube's own filter chips with their official encodings. On the first page of every run the actor decodes those chips and compares them to its own encoder. If YouTube ever renumbers an enum, the actor adopts YouTube's value, logs the drift, and re-runs the query — instead of silently handing you unfiltered results.
Measured on the proof runs: 24 of 24 encodings byte-identical to YouTube's own chips
(type=video → EgIQAQ==, duration>20m → EgIYAg==, VR180 → EgPQAQE=, …), and the actor
logged encoder confirmed against 23 live filter chips on every platform run.
🧩 The wedges — what this does that the search response does not hand you
- Shorts get a channel. YouTube's
shortsLockupViewModelhas a title, a view count and a thumbnail, and nothing else — no channel name, no ID, no handle. The uploader'sUC…ID is embedded in the reel endpoint's params protobuf, so it is recovered there. Verified against the videos' own watch pages: 4 of 4 exact matches, then 51 of 51 Shorts rows on the platform. - Collaboration videos keep their channel. When two creators co-upload, YouTube replaces the
byline link with a "Collaborators" dialog — a parser that only reads the byline loses
channelIdandchannelHandleon those rows. Here they are read from the dialog, and every collaborator ships incollaborators[]with ID, handle and subscriber count. - Chapters without a second request. 1,811 chapters across 190 of 600 rows, from the same response — no extra fetch, no extra latency, no extra charge.
"No views"is0, not null. A brand-new upload has a real, meaningful zero."15 watching"is never mis-read as a view count. It lands inliveViewerCount.

⚠️ Honest limits — read these before you buy
- YouTube caps how deep one query goes. Measured to exhaustion on the platform:
"plumber"ran dry at 473 unique results / 31 pages,"best crm software"at 347 / 20 pages. Then the continuation token goes null and the query ends (the log saysno further pages). This is YouTube's ceiling, not this actor's — every YouTube search scraper hits it. Plan for volume by running many queries and filter variants, not one enormous one. - YouTube's continuation chain repeats itself. Measured 151 duplicates in 971 raw rows (15.6%)
on the depth run. They are dropped by ID before
pushData, so you are never billed for them — but it is why "20 results per page × 30 pages" does not equal 600 unique rows. - The publish date is relative, not absolute. Search returns
"6 years ago", never an ISO date.publishedTimeApproxis that string resolved against the scrape time, so it is exact to YouTube's own granularity and no better. It is namedApproxon purpose. An exact timestamp needs a second request per video, which this actor deliberately does not make. - Live rows have no duration and no publish date. That is YouTube, not a bug — a live row
carries
liveViewerCountinstead. Verified: 20 of 20 rows under thelivefilter. - Shorts rows are thin by nature. YouTube gives a Shorts result a title, a view count and a
thumbnail. This actor adds
channelId(100% of 51 rows). It cannot give you the channel name or @handle for a Short, because they are not in the payload. videoCountText/videoCounton channel rows measured 0/80. YouTube currently puts the subscriber count in that slot instead. The parser reads those fields by content rather than by name, so they will populate again if YouTube restores them — today they are empty, and this README says so rather than pretending.- No per-video enrichment. Like count, comment count, subscriber count on a video row, full
description, keywords and tags are not in the search response. They need a separate
/playeror/nextcall per video. This actor is one request per page, on purpose — it does not claim fields it cannot see. - Sustained very-high volume is unproven. 86 consecutive requests came back clean. Nobody has
run this at tens of thousands of requests an hour. If you do and YouTube starts refusing, the run
exits cleanly with a "blocked" status message — never as "no results found", and never as a
FAILED run. Switch
proxyConfigurationtoRESIDENTIAL, or bring your own proxy. - Residential proxy costs bandwidth. A result is roughly 36 KB of response. On Apify Proxy
auto(the default) bandwidth is not billed. On residential at ~$8/GB it is about $0.29 per 1,000 rows — still comfortably inside the price, but do not switch it on out of habit.
⚖️ Legal & fair use
This actor reads YouTube's public search results — the same rows any visitor sees, with no login, no account, no cookies and no CAPTCHA solving. It collects no personal data: channels are public business/creator profiles, and no viewer or commenter information is touched.
https://www.youtube.com/robots.txt lists, under User-agent: *:
Disallow: /resultsDisallow: /youtubei/
That is quoted here verbatim so you can make your own call. robots.txt is a crawling convention, not law, and it applies to indexing crawlers; you are responsible for your own use of the output and for compliance with YouTube's Terms of Service in your jurisdiction. Keep request volume reasonable, do not republish YouTube content wholesale, and use the data for research, analysis and internal tooling.
